Ski pass San Martino Di Castrozza
Ski runs for more than 60 km, at between 1,404 and 2,357 m altitude, within a unique natural landscape, covering every difficulty of grades, with exciting routes accessible to beginners and thrilling to expert skiers. In total there are24 ski-lift facilities in operation.
To ski on the Carosello delle Malghe (45 km of runs in the charming areas of Tognola, Valcigolera and Ces), on Colverde and Passo Rolle you can either use the valley ski pass or the Dolomiti Superski pass.

* Junior: born after 27.11.1995 (document required) * Senior: born before 27.11.1946 (document required)
Children until 8 years (born after 28.11.2003) are entitled to a free skipass for the same period (except daily, 12 days in a season and season passes) on purchase of a skipass by the adult relative. This free offer refers to "a parent for each child".
